Causes
- Multimedia (infotainment) module not powered or in sleep mode
- Open or short in CAN high/low wiring between multimedia module and body network
- Poor or corroded connector(s) at the multimedia unit, BCM, or junctions
- CAN bus termination missing or incorrect resistance
- High bus error rate or bus-off condition on the CAN network
- Software/firmware bug or configuration mismatch in multimedia or BCM
Symptoms
- Clock/time on instrument cluster or infotainment screen not updating or blank
- Warning or message about multimedia communication on the cluster
- Related features tied to clock (scheduled events, navigation time) incorrect
- Intermittent or permanent loss of multimedia functions
- Multiple communication-related DTCs present
What to check
- Read and record all stored and pending DTCs and freeze-frame data with a capable scan tool
- Check fuses and power/ground at the multimedia module and BCM
- Visually inspect connectors and harnesses for damage, corrosion or poor seating
- Measure CAN bus termination resistance (~60 ohm across CAN H and CAN L with ignition off) or 120 ohm depending on network topology
- Use a scan tool to confirm whether the multimedia module is communicating on the network
- Check for other modules reporting CAN errors (bus-off) or high error counts
Signal parameters
- Expected periodic clock/multimedia CAN message: typically 1 Hz (once per second) or periodic heartbeat — confirm exact interval from OEM docs
- CAN bus idle voltages: approx. CAN_H 2.5 V, CAN_L 2.5 V (recessive); differential amplitude ~2.5–3.5 V when dominant
- Normal high-speed CAN bit rate for body/infotainment networks: commonly 500 kbps or 250 kbps (verify for model)
- Expected message ID for clock/time: manufacturer-specific — verify in wiring/service manual or CAN database
- Termination resistance: approx. 60 ohm measured across CAN_H and CAN_L (two 120 ohm in parallel) depending on vehicle
Diagnostic algorithm
- Capture scan-tool data: record B295700 plus any related U-/B-codes, note conditions (ignition state, engine off/on).
- Verify multimedia module power and grounds: check fuses, ignition-switched supply, and chassis ground at the unit.
- Inspect and reseat connectors at the multimedia unit, BCM and any intermediate gateways. Check for corrosion or bent pins.
- Confirm the multimedia module appears on the network using a scan tool or module list. If it is absent, focus on power, grounds and local wiring.
- Measure CAN bus wiring continuity between multimedia unit and nearest gateway/BCM. Look for opens, high resistance, or shorts to battery/ground.
- Check termination resistance with ignition off. If termination is incorrect, isolate wiring segments to find missing/extra resistor.
- Use an oscilloscope or CAN analyzer to view CAN_H and CAN_L while attempting communication. Look for proper differential signals, noise, or bus-off events.
- If bus messages are present but clock message is missing, check for software level issues: confirm module software versions and update per OEM service information.
- Clear codes and perform a road/ignition cycle to see if the code returns. If intermittent, try to reproduce under the same conditions reported.
- If wiring, power and termination are good but message still missing, consider replacing or bench-testing the multimedia module (or BCM/gateway) per OEM procedures.
- After repair or module replacement, reprogram/configure modules if required and verify normal operation and no recurrence of the code.
Likely causes
- Loose or corroded connector at the infotainment unit or BCM
- Multimedia unit not powering up due to fuse or ignition supply fault
- Intermittent CAN wiring (broken strand, pinched harness) causing message loss
- CAN bus termination problem (open or extra resistor)
- Module software needing reflash or module in a fault state
Fault status
Status
Multimedia CAN Clock message timeout—infotainment clock data was not received on the vehicle CAN network within the expected timeout window.
